About Leon County

North Florida capital county in the Tallahassee Hills with rolling terrain, red clay Orangeburg and Tifton series soils, and underlying karst Floridan Aquifer. Clay subsoils limit percolation in upland areas, often requiring drip-dispersal or low-pressure dosing septic systems. Sinkhole lakes and springs indicate direct connections between surface and groundwater, making well placement and septic siting critical.

Septic Inspection in Leon County — common questions

How often do I need septic inspection?

Septic Inspection is typically scheduled annually for routine maintenance, or before any property sale. Local conditions (household size, soil type, water usage) can shift that window, so a licensed pro will set a cadence that fits your system.

How much does septic inspection cost in Leon County, FL?

Septic Inspection typically ranges $150 – $900 nationally (HomeGuide, Angi 2026). Actual prices depend on scope, site access, soil conditions, and local permitting. All providers on this site offer free, no-obligation quotes so you can compare before committing.
